For a long time, I was doing archive rebuilds using an absolutely minimal /etc/hosts file with only two lines: one for localhost and another one for the hostname. After I added the IPv6 lines that debian-installer creates by default, several packages which mysteriously FTBFS for me for unknown reasons (like this one) suddenly started to build ok. This allowed me to remove those packages from my "list of packages which FTBFS", without even reporting the problem as a bug and of course without making any upload. I think this is the optimal thing to do in this particular case, so I no longer see the need to make any upload for bullseye. The package effectively builds ok in bullseye for me, and I believe it would also build ok in the setup used by Lucas these days. Thanks.
